Ghost Electric Concert History

Ghost Electric formed in 2009. Members include; David Shanley (guitar and keyboards), Clint Brown (bass), Mark Abbruzzese (vocals) and Lyle Michael Derby (drums and shakers). Ghost Electric's music is a moody and eclectic jumble of Alternative Metal pulling from the band member’s diverse interests; Bowie, Pink Floyd, Tool, The Darkness, Ben Kweller, Stone Temple Pilots, Stevie Wonder, Led Zeppelin and Elbow. The idea is to discover each song’s inner bits, colors and textures, pushing swells, sweetness, and wails thunder.
